Getting Started

System Requirements

  • macOS 13.0 (Ventura) or higher
  • Approximately 10MB of available storage space
  • Intel or Apple Silicon processor

Installation

  1. Download the latest version of ImmersiveTime from the download page.
  2. Unzip the downloaded file.
  3. Drag the ImmersiveTime application to your Applications folder.
  4. Launch ImmersiveTime from your Applications folder or using Spotlight.

First Launch

When you first launch ImmersiveTime, you'll see the app icon appear in your menu bar. Click on the icon to access the main menu. From here, you can:

  • View the current time in your local time zone
  • Add additional time zones
  • Access the app's preferences
  • Set up countdowns

Managing Time Zones

Adding Time Zones

  1. Click on the ImmersiveTime menu bar icon
  2. Select "Add Time Zone" from the menu
  3. Search for a city or time zone name, or browse by region
  4. Click on the desired time zone to add it to your list

Removing Time Zones

  1. Click on the ImmersiveTime menu bar icon
  2. Right-click (or Control-click) on the time zone you want to remove
  3. Select "Remove" from the context menu

Reordering Time Zones

You can change the order of your time zones in the preferences:

  1. Click on the ImmersiveTime menu bar icon
  2. Select "Preferences" from the menu
  3. Go to the "Time Zones" tab
  4. Drag and drop time zones to reorder them

Floating Clock

The floating clock feature allows you to have a clock window that stays on top of other windows, making it easy to keep track of time while working.

Enabling the Floating Clock

  1. Click on the ImmersiveTime menu bar icon
  2. Select "Show Floating Clock" from the menu

Customizing the Floating Clock

You can customize the appearance and behavior of the floating clock:

  1. Click on the ImmersiveTime menu bar icon
  2. Select "Preferences" from the menu
  3. Go to the "Floating Clock" tab
  4. Adjust size, opacity, position, and other settings

Moving the Floating Clock

You can drag the floating clock to any position on your screen. The position will be remembered between app launches.

Countdown Feature

ImmersiveTime includes a countdown feature that allows you to track time until important events.

Creating a Countdown

  1. Click on the ImmersiveTime menu bar icon
  2. Select "Countdown" from the menu
  3. Choose "New Countdown"
  4. Enter a name for your countdown
  5. Set the target date and time
  6. Click "Create"

Using Preset Countdowns

ImmersiveTime includes preset countdowns for common holidays and events:

  1. Click on the ImmersiveTime menu bar icon
  2. Select "Countdown" from the menu
  3. Choose "Preset Countdowns"
  4. Select a preset from the list

Managing Countdowns

You can view, edit, and delete your countdowns:

  1. Click on the ImmersiveTime menu bar icon
  2. Select "Countdown" from the menu
  3. Choose "Manage Countdowns"
  4. From here, you can edit or delete existing countdowns

Preferences

ImmersiveTime offers various customization options through its preferences panel.

General Preferences

  • Launch at login: Set ImmersiveTime to start automatically when you log in
  • Time format: Choose between 12-hour and 24-hour time formats
  • Show seconds: Toggle the display of seconds in the time
  • Menu bar display options: Customize what information appears in the menu bar

Appearance

  • Theme: Choose between light, dark, or system theme
  • Custom colors: Set custom colors for various elements
  • Background image: Add a custom background image
  • Transparency and blur: Adjust the transparency and blur effects

Notifications

  • Countdown notifications: Get notified when countdowns reach zero
  • Time zone change notifications: Get notified about daylight saving time changes
  • Custom alerts: Set up alerts for specific times

Keyboard Shortcuts

ImmersiveTime supports several keyboard shortcuts to enhance productivity:

ActionShortcut
Open main menu⌘+Shift+T
Show/hide floating clock⌘+Shift+F
Open preferences⌘+,
Add new time zone⌘+Shift+N
Create new countdown⌘+Shift+C
Quit application⌘+Q

Troubleshooting

Common Issues

ImmersiveTime doesn't appear in the menu bar

Try these steps:

  1. Restart the application
  2. Check if you have too many menu bar items which might be causing some to be hidden
  3. Try restarting your Mac

Time zones are incorrect

Ensure your system time and time zone are set correctly. ImmersiveTime relies on your system's time settings as a reference.

Application crashes on startup

Try removing the application's preferences file:

  1. Open Finder
  2. Press ⌘+Shift+G
  3. Enter ~/Library/Preferences/
  4. Find and delete any files containing 'immersivetime' in their name
  5. Restart the application
